Newcastle United Initiate Talks for Manchester City's Nico Gonzalez Amid Midfield Overhaul
Newcastle United have begun negotiations with Manchester City to bring in Spanish midfielder Nico Gonzalez, aiming to fill the gap left by departures of key players Bruno Guimaraes and Sandro Tonali. The Magpies are eager to strengthen their midfield following a summer of significant exits.
Formal Discussions Underway
According to talkSPORT, Newcastle has advanced from initial inquiries to formal talks regarding the 24-year-old Gonzalez, who has struggled to secure consistent playing time under manager Enzo Maresca at the Etihad Stadium. The club views Gonzalez as a strong candidate to add Premier League experience and technical skill to their squad before the transfer window closes.
Scouts at St James' Park believe Gonzalez fits the profile needed to enhance both the tactical discipline and technical quality of their midfield. Both clubs appear willing to find common ground, suggesting that a deal could materialize soon.
Filling the Void Left by Guimaraes and Tonali
The urgency to sign Gonzalez is driven by Newcastle's loss of two vital midfielders this summer. Bruno Guimaraes and Sandro Tonali's departures have created a noticeable absence in the center of the pitch, and head coach Matthias Jaissle is keen to address this swiftly.
Gonzalez’s versatility is a major asset; he can operate as a defensive midfielder or box-to-box player, providing Jaissle with the tactical options he seeks. His arrival could also boost morale among fans, especially after Guimaraes’ exit was felt deeply.
Gonzalez Looks for Regular First-Team Football
For Gonzalez, moving to Newcastle offers a chance to regain momentum in his career. Since joining Manchester City for £52 million in February 2025, the midfielder has appeared 41 times across all competitions but has not secured a regular starting spot, especially toward the end of last season.
At 24, Gonzalez is entering what many consider his prime years and wants guaranteed first-team action. Newcastle can promise a central role in midfield, making the prospect appealing to both the player and his representatives.
Critical Time for Jaissle and Newcastle's Recruitment
With the transfer deadline approaching, pressure mounts on Matthias Jaissle and the recruitment team to complete their squad rebuilding. The club's management understands that replacing lost quality is essential to maintaining progress.
Negotiations are expected to be challenging, as Newcastle aims to avoid overpaying yet knows that acquiring a player like Gonzalez, especially from a direct competitor, is a rare opportunity. For supporters, this signing would provide welcome relief after a summer marked by high-profile departures.
